Young Innocence Shattered: Children Caught in Crossfire of Gun Violence

TL;DR Summary
An 8-year-old boy in Detroit was shot and injured in a drive-by shooting. The child, who was inside an apartment unit, is in stable condition after being taken to the hospital. Police suspect the gunfire came from two vehicles possibly shooting at each other, but the motive is unknown. The incident occurred in a kid-friendly area, and authorities are investigating the case.
